CCPA Releases Guidelines to Prevent and Regulate Greenwashing and Misleading Environmental Claims.

National | Dated: 24 Oct 2024

The Central Consumer Protection Authority (CCPA) has issued guidelines called 'Guidelines for Prevention and Regulation of Greenwashing or Misleading Environmental Claims, 2024.' These guidelines aim to stop and regulate greenwashing and misleading environmental claims.

🎯 Key Highlights:

  • - This initiative tackles the increasing issue of false marketing practices that confuse consumers about the environmental benefits of products, while also promoting sustainable business practices.
  • - The primary goal of these guidelines is to shield consumers from misleading information while promoting genuine environmental responsibility within the business community.

💡 Other Important Facts:

  • A committee, headed by Nidhi Khare (Secretary of the Department of Consumer Affairs, MoCA), which included members from academia, legal experts, consumer organizations, and industry representatives, developed these guidelines after thorough discussions.
